    lol, this was maybe a litte exagerated but the fonts are very hard to read. It's definately to do with the small size as the fonts are sharp enough - just too small.

    I'm using Svideo TV out from my FX5200. This is connected to scart on my std 4:3 Sony 28" TV via fully wired gold plated cable. I'm using 800 X 600 res. I've tried the reccomended PAL resolution 720x576 but there was no difference in quality/size and my setup seems happier in 800 X 600.
